How they compare

Austria currently reports 0.1861 against 0.1841 in Bulgaria, a difference of 0.002.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 25 shared years of data; in 1995 it was Bulgaria ahead.

Austria ranks 16th and Bulgaria ranks 18th of 43 countries.

Bulgaria has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Austria Bulgaria Difference Ahead
1990s 0.2282 0.2525 0.0243 Bulgaria
2000s 0.2216 0.2315 0.0099 Bulgaria
2010s 0.2015 0.2307 0.0292 Bulgaria

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
